MicroRNAs (miRNAs) function as master regulators of gene expression. Recent studies demonstrate that miRNA isoforms (isomiRs) play a unique role during cancer development. National Cancer Institute researchers have developed QuagmiR, the first cloud-based tool to analyze isomiRs from next generation sequencing data. Using a novel and flexible searching algorithm designed for the detection and annotation of heterogeneous isomiRs, it permits extensive customization of the query process and reference databases to meet the user’s diverse research needs.
Availability – QuagmiR is written in Python and can be obtained freely from GitHub at: https://github.com/Gu-Lab-RBL-NCI/QuagmiR
